General description
1-Octanesulfonic acid sodium is an anionic detergent and a surfactant with excellent coupling properties. This versatile molecule finds application as a buffer component, in cell biology, analytical chemistry, and biochemical research.
Application
1-Octanesulfonic acid sodium salt has been used:
- as a component of 9 parts buffer to determine the concentration of L-Dopa in extracts of seed flour
- in mobile phase solution to measure dopamine in rats using high-performance liquid chromatography (HPLC) analysis
- in neurochemistry for the preparation of mobile phase buffer for HPLC analysis.
Ion-pairing reagent for HPLC analysis of peptides and proteins.
